Pregnancy Massage – SMT101
The pregnancy massage course is a hands-on workshop designed to guide massage therapists and other perinatal professionals as they strive to address the physiological and emotional needs of the perinatal woman. Participants learn techniques to lessen musculoskeletal pain and reduce prenatal and birth complications through touch. Students are introduced to the management of high-risk pregnancies and difficult pregnancies, and design personalized massage sessions that reflect the prenatal, birth and postnatal stages. Included are effective draping techniques, positioning clients and gentle movement exercises to facilitate birth and post-natal recovery. This is an 8-hour course.
